What is Montgomery County SPCA’s adoption process?

At the Montgomery County SPCA, we are dedicated to finding responsible, forever homes for all the pets in our care. To that end, we have created a thorough adoption process which helps us achieve this goal. This process includes a check of veterinary history records on any pets you currently have, and a home visit. If you rent your home, we require written proof (letter or lease) from your landlord that you are allowed to have pets. We undertake this kind of thorough review to ensure that animals who have already been discarded at least once will never have to experience this again.
